SQL Server 2008可以水平扩展吗?

时间:2011-07-05 03:39:34

标签: sql sql-server sql-server-2008

我已经读过SQL Server无法水平扩展。这是真的吗?

我正在计划一个高流量的网站,并寻找一个可以在多个服务器上轻松扩展的数据库。

3 个答案:

答案 0 :(得分:9)

不,这不是真的 SQL服务器scale horizontally可以使用partitioning

答案 1 :(得分:1)

最近,SQL 2012提供了更多水平扩展选项。

http://robtiffany.com/building-microsoft-meap-scaling-out-sql-server/

答案 2 :(得分:-1)

上周我听说过partitiondb,这对我很有帮助。你只需要创建一个控制所有分区数据库的数据库,它就能很好地管理它们。您所需要的只是声明您的partitionid。

例如,如果您的网站正在处理销售,您可以通过storeid对数据库进行分区。然后每个商店驻留在不同的数据库实例或不同的服务器上。所有这些都是从一个模板db管理的,这给人一种面向对象建模的感觉。